aboutsummaryrefslogtreecommitdiff
path: root/gcc/value-range.cc
diff options
context:
space:
mode:
authorAldy Hernandez <aldyh@redhat.com>2022-10-19 19:28:09 +0200
committerAldy Hernandez <aldyh@redhat.com>2022-10-20 16:09:18 +0200
commitbe43d5d3051589ee00f6685103539dced767c47d (patch)
treeff7e1334ff43d035359b93a468ebc6a2087dd283 /gcc/value-range.cc
parentc75ee0bffabfd6056e29e7a421ae8e9615639a8f (diff)
downloadgcc-be43d5d3051589ee00f6685103539dced767c47d.zip
gcc-be43d5d3051589ee00f6685103539dced767c47d.tar.gz
gcc-be43d5d3051589ee00f6685103539dced767c47d.tar.bz2
Replace finite_operands_p with maybe_isnan.
The finite_operands_p function was incorrectly named, as it only returned TRUE when !NAN. This was leftover from the initial implementation of frange. Using the maybe_isnan() nomenclature is more consistent and easier to understand. gcc/ChangeLog: * range-op-float.cc (finite_operand_p): Remove. (finite_operands_p): Rename to... (maybe_isnan): ...this. (frelop_early_resolve): Use maybe_isnan instead of finite_operands_p. (foperator_equal::fold_range): Same. (foperator_equal::op1_range): Same. (foperator_not_equal::fold_range): Same. (foperator_lt::fold_range): Same. (foperator_le::fold_range): Same. (foperator_gt::fold_range): Same. (foperator_ge::fold_range): Same.
Diffstat (limited to 'gcc/value-range.cc')
0 files changed, 0 insertions, 0 deletions